chaya

English

Etymology 1

From Japanese ?? (chaya).

Noun

chaya (plural chayas)

  1. A teahouse in Japan.

Etymology 2

From Spanish chaya.

Noun

chaya

  1. A large, fast-growing leafy perennial Mexican shrub which is popular in Mexico and Central America as a leafy vegetable, cooked and eaten like spinach, from species Cnidoscolus aconitifolius or Cnidoscolus chayamansa.
Synonyms
  • tree spinach
Translations

See also

  • chaya root

Etymology 3

From Hebrew ??????? (khayá, alive).

Alternative forms

  • chayah, haya, hayah

Noun

chaya

  1. (Judaism) One of the cabalistic aspects of the soul, related to the personality.
Coordinate terms
  • nefesh
  • neshama/neshamah
  • ruach
  • yechidah

khaya

English

Pronunciation

  • Rhymes: -e??

Etymology 1

From the Nguni group of languages khaya (home)

Noun

khaya (plural khayas)

  1. (South Africa, strictly) A native house or hut.
  2. (South Africa, loosely) Servants' quarters separated from the main house.
  3. (South Africa, slang) Anyone's house or home.

Etymology 2

Borrowed from Wolof khaye (African mahogany tree).

Noun

khaya (plural khayas)

  1. Any tree of the genus Khaya.
